What to Do After a Car Accident in Surprise, AZ

If you get injured in a car accident in Surprise, there are certain steps that you should take right away to defend your rights and protect yourself physically and financially. Keep this list of basic steps in your vehicle or with you in case you get into a car accident. This list covers your responsibilities as a driver as well as tips to help you protect yourself. Here’s what to do:

  1. Pull over as close to the scene of the accident as you can without putting yourself in danger.
  2. Check yourself and others involved in the crash for injuries and render aid, if possible.
  3. Call the police right away to report the accident.
  4. Exchange names and contact information with the other driver.
  5. Do not admit fault for the accident.
  6. Take pictures before leaving the scene of the crash.
  7. Go to a hospital in Surprise immediately for professional medical care.
  8. Call the other driver’s car insurance company to file your initial claim.
  9. Do not accept a fast settlement offer. It may be less than your case is worth.
  10. Contact a car accident lawyer near you as soon as possible for professional assistance.

Common Causes of Motor Vehicle Accidents

When you are on the road driving safely and responsibly and are hit by another driver, it will certainly come as a surprise to you. Many accidents today are caused by the fact that other drivers do not behave safely and responsibly. When a driver is violating the rules of the road and not operating their vehicle safely and attentively, they will be liable for any damages in accidents they cause. Common examples of driver errors and other hazards behind car accidents in Arizona include:

  • Distracted driving
  • Texting and driving
  • Driving under the influence
  • Speeding
  • Following too closely
  • Reckless driving
  • Making illegal turns
  • Unsafe passing
  • Driving drowsy
  • Running red lights
  • Violating traffic laws
  • Defective auto parts
  • Road hazards

All drivers in Arizona must carry liability car insurance to pay for car accidents that they cause.

To collect damages from another driver in your accident, you’ll need to prove that they were at fault for the accident, which requires evidence. To collect damages, you’ll also need to collect evidence to prove them, which is where your Surprise car accident lawyer is of particular value.

Distracted Drivers Cause Substantial Numbers of Surprise Accidents

One of the most common causes of accidents on the roads today is distracted driving. According to the National Highway Safety Transportation Administration, some 3,142 people died on the roads of the US in 2020 due to distracted driving.

Common forms of distracted driving include:

  • Talking on the phone while driving
  • Texting while driving
  • Fiddling with the radio or in-dash display
  • Anything that takes the eyes off the road, mind off driving, and hands off the wheel

Proving distracted driving may require accessing the other driver’s cell phone records. A lawyer can help you with this task by sending a Letter of Preservation to the driver’s cell phone provider. Other types of evidence can include video footage of the driver in the moments leading up to the crash, pictures of the inside of the driver’s cab and eyewitness statements.

Statute of Limitations on Car Accident Claims in Arizona

Do not delay in contacting an attorney if you believe you have grounds to file a car accident claim. A law known as Arizona’s statute of limitations gives crash victims a time limit of two years from the date of the accident to bring a legal cause of action. If you miss the statute of limitations, the courts will most likely refuse to hear your case, even if you have proof that a driver or another party caused the wreck. There are only rare exceptions to this rule, so contact an attorney as soon as possible to avoid losing your right to recover.
